Occupational Therapy Assistant Hourly Wage Breakdown
| Percentile | Hourly Rate | Per 8hr Shift |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$26.59 | $212.69 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$30.96 | $247.65 |
| Median (P50) | $35.74 | $285.89 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$38.41 | $307.28 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$42.40 | $339.19 |

Hourly Rate Trajectory for Occupational Therapy Assistants in Lufkin (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 2.81% projection.
| Year | Hourly Rate |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$29.57/hr | Actual |
| 2020 | $30.26/hr | Actual |
| 2021 | $29.68/hr | Actual |
| 2022 | $30.89/hr | Actual |
| 2023 | $32.22/hr | Actual |
| 2024 | $33.29/hr | Actual |
| 2025 | $34.76/hr |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$35.74/hr | Estimated |
| 2027 | $36.74/hr |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S metropolitan area data, the median hourly rate for occupational therapy assistants in Lufkin grew 17.5% from $29.57/hr (2019) to $34.76/hr (2025). At a 2.81% projected growth rate, hourly pay is expected to reach $36.74/hr by 2027.
